Kusabue Mitsuko
Mitsukô Kusabue was born on October 22, 1933 in Yokohama, Japan. She is an actress, known for The Lost World of Sinbad (1963), Miyamoto Musashi (1984) and Shikonmado - Dai tatsumaki (1964).

Tamiya Jiro
Tamiya Jiro was born on August 25, 1935 in Kyoto City, Japan as Shibata Goro. He was an actor and producer, known for Miyamoto Musashi (1973), 3000 kiro no wana (1971) and Showdown at Night's End (1964). He was married to Fuji Yukiko. He died on December 29, 1978 in Tokyo, Japan.
